Form design principles: Carousel display of landing and registration page. Facebook. At first, a single-choice form design. The Mobile.Design [+]Creator graphic digital content, graphic items and editable files are designed and made to have the exact sizes, the perfect resolutions and the right names requested by iOS and Android standards. Design patterns are solutions to general problems that software developers faced during software development. Much has changed since this book's first edition. Gestures. Creational Design Patterns This design pattern is known as class-creation or object creation pattern. To build an effective mobile UI, designers have to consider aspects like defining their users and the way they think, understand UI design patterns, be able to work with various design tools and come up with a unique aesthetic that meets project requirements. Code Patterns. You can also use the customized pattern in any commercial project. The pattern typically shows relationships and interactions between classes or objects. This mobile banking system designed by Raiyaan Md uses basic geometric patterns to transform a simple design into something dynamic. Below, you will get information about the 3 main types of design patterns. On the bustling Yuyuan Road in Shanghai, China, ROOI designed a vibrant store for a local clothing brand called All Beings. 5. It is most challenging for forms-based UIs, while for UIs con-. These solutions were obtained by trial and error by numerous software developers over quite a substantial period of time. BuzzFeed is a content sharing platform and a pretty awesome one, if you may ask. Introduction In the first article of this mini-series dedicated to Mobile Design Patterns, I gave a brief overview of what they are and the importance of their. Code patterns leverage multiple technologies, products, or services to solve issues that our developer advocates have recognized as common use cases across multiple industries. A design pattern provides a general reusable solution for the common problems that occur in software design. Mobile Design Pattern for Gallery. From Wikipedia: - In software engineering, a software design pattern is a general, reusable solution to a commonly occurring problem within a given context in software design. Furthermore, it got a shorter name as "GoF Design Patterns". Code patterns offer up complete solutions to problems that developers face every day. The Role of White Space in User Interface Design Repetition Repetition in design can work in a number of different ways. This great example shows the power of combining different mobile navigation patterns. Feb 5, 2016 - Pttrns is the finest collection of design patterns, resources and inspiration. Multi-step actions and fill-in forms In Sam's login/registration form design example, it has a clear logic of login and registration. Chapter 1 [What are UI Design Patterns and How to Use Them] - Get a better understanding of how to think about design patterns, so you are more equipped at utilizing them in your everyday projects. If we have to change behavior of an object based on its state, we can have a state variable in the Object and use if-else condition block to perform different actions based on the state. Want more inspiration? The top header section boasts a logo, menu options, slider menu navigation, and search bar. Mobile design specialists Steven Hoober and Eric Berkman have collected and researched 76 best . Download and use 10,000+ Pattern stock photos for free. Want more inspiration? All the screenshots are grouped by elements or patterns. Mobile OSes have become increasingly different, driving their own design conventions and patterns, and many designers have embraced mobile . Mobile Development Code Patterns. There are quite a few architecture design patterns out there for mobile development. Basically every consideration in interaction design happens for a drag and drop interaction. Having repeating design elements within work is not inherently a flawed approach. This handy reference provides more than 90 mobile app design patterns, illustrated by 1,000 screenshots from current Android, iOS, and Windows Phone apps. All icons formats will be saved with required name and dimensions. The book was authored by Erich Gamma, Richard Helm, Ralph Johnson, and John Vlissides. Progressive disclosure filter pattern (Nested levels) For enterprise contexts, you'll want to leverage expandable sections and dropdowns. Mobile app design patterns allow you to create multiple paths, so you can analyze all activities by categories and discover users' behavioral habits. Easily and quickly. Images 2.36m Collections 221 Get goosebumps with 30% OFF on the Annual Plan Go Premium Next page New assets WELIE isn't the prettiest site we've ever seen but there's a very useful interaction design patterns library which is logically grouped and incredibly helpful. This handy reference provides more than 90 mobile app design patterns, illustrated by 1,000 screenshots from current Android, iOS, and Windows Phone apps. This book was first published in 1994 and it's one of the most popular books to learn design patterns. Chapter 2 [The Interactive Imperative] - Learn about the most commonly available gestures and animations to add interactivity to your mobile app. Here are some pattern tips & tricks to enhance mobile filtering in your enterprise product. - It is not a finished design that can be transformed directly into source or machine code. It has a series of screenshots of 170 apps and over 10,000 patterns. Because patterns are common design practices, they're familiar to users. Free for commercial use High Quality Images. Mobbin is a hand-picked collection of the latest mobile design patterns from apps that reflect the best in design. ; Application Design for Web and Desktop: GUI screen components, workflows, user types . Search all Code Patterns. Here are some common UX patterns you should be familiar with. These mobile application design patterns can be categorized into 3 main design patterns. Available for free or premium in line, flat, gradient, isometric, glyph, sticker & more design styles. Here we analyzed 5 design patterns: Classic MVC Apple's MVC or extended MVC for android MVP MVVM Viper Classic MVC Architecture The MVC is the first approach to describe as well as implement software development based on their responsibilities. Pattern-based UIs will usually require less learning by users. Here's some background in case you're just joining us mid-series: Designing for Mobile, Part 1: Information Architecture demonstrated the key challenges designers face when designing for mobile, primarily the mobile context: from viewing conditions, to behavior and emotion. Mobile Design Patterns designs, themes, templates and downloadable graphic elements on Dribbble Popular Mobile Design Patterns Inspirational designs, illustrations, and graphic elements from the world's best designers. Expand touch targets At the heart of many new mobile design patterns is the evolution of gestures and animations in mobile development. Engagement. My Pattern Designer. This book provides practical techniques to help you catch--and keep--their attention. Dwell into the patterns below to learn a common language of web design. Mobbin Design is a mobile app UX design pattern library for iOS. Many people say that they are overly complicated and make code more difficult t. Read it now on the O'Reilly learning platform with a 10-day free trial. It encourages designers to take into account the user gripping their mobile device with one hand. Browse our search results . I will create an unique seamless pattern for you 4.9 ( 382) Starting at $30 p parradesigner I will create exclusive and amazing seamless pattern 5.0 ( 297) Starting at $5 a abdelalijordani I will design a seamless luxury monogram pattern for your brand 5.0 ( 39) Starting at $10 n nookshawn Top Rated Seller All the locks can be removed without any data loss. In the GoF book, the purpose of a design pattern is described like this: A design pattern names,. They have carefully hand-picked over 170 apps and 10,000 patterns (screenshots from iPhone X) from app stores of different countries, not just the US. Mobile UI Patterns for Notifications. GoF Design Pattern Types Design patterns are standard reference points for the experienced user interface designer. Pinterest, Spotify, Uber, Instagram, Dropbox, Flipboard, Mailbox, Yelp - they all use mobile UI design patterns explained in this e-book. android. For more on design patterns, check out the following courses: Mobile User Experience: Essential UX design principles for small-screen websites and apps; Web Page UX Design: Designing successful web pages based on content priority, visual design, and the right page components to meet objectives. Account registration - This may sound simple, but account registration has the most room for UX design pitfalls. Pattern Tap. This handy reference provides more than 90 mobile app design patterns, illustrated by 1,000 screenshots from current Android, iOS, and Windows Phone apps. Components. A design pattern in architecture and computer science is a formal way of documenting a solution to a design problem in a particular field of expertise. Use what you need and scrap the rest - but make sure to tailor them to solve your own problems and, most importantly, those of your . - Don't reinvent the wheel while you can look up . 5 Best Mobile Form Design Examples for Better UX in 2018. After that, it's much easier to personalize the product and provide each user with offers that match his/her individual needs. For a deeper look at how some of the hottest companies are implementing new and existing user input design patterns as well as 45+ other patterns, check out UXPin's new e-book, Mobile UI Design Patterns 2014. Download 516 Mobile Pattern Design Vector Icons for commercial and personal use. Stay ahead of the curve and become a better interface designer. Much has changed since this book's first edition. Facebook is known for many things - one of which is its mobile navigation. They allow for debate over alternatives, where merely mentioning the name of a design pattern implicitly carries much more meaning than merely the name. Pairing geometric patterns with white space and simple design elements creates balance and allows . See more ideas about mobile design patterns, mobile design, design. Dropbox - by Sam Atmore. 3. You can export your designs as SVG, PNG, and CSS. Creational Design Pattern 2. Welcome to Designing for Mobile, Part 2: Interaction Design. 10 great mobile navigation examples. The model-view-controller (MVC) design pattern is the earliest architectural pattern that is made up of three parts: Model - the backend business logic and data View - the interface components to display the data. Pattern Images It is said that repetition breeds success. Priority+ pattern. ROOI design unveils all beings store in shanghai. Since design patterns are already defined, it makes our code easy to understand and debug. 28 Design Patterns for User Interface for Mobile Applications 309 the user interface. With a Pttrns membership, gain access to thousands of curated mobile design patterns, get online advice, and connect with other designers from all over the world. However, it is still quite helpful for those searching for creative ideas. Sep 14, 2017 - Explore Hollie Phillips's board "Mobile Design Patterns" on Pinterest. She provides numerous examples of mobile design patterns and Designing for Mobile, Part 2: Interaction Design on mobile screen. OOP design pattern is a typical solution to a common problem in software design. When you're under pressure to produce a well designed, easy-to-navigate mobile app, there's no time to reinvent the wheel. Mobile Design Pattern Gallery: UI Patterns for Smartphone Apps $26.72 (36) Only 6 left in stock (more on the way). But what are some patterns of mobile UX design that you should know about? Mobile UI Design. Mobile Patterns - UI UX Inspirational Gallery for iOS and Android. Mobbin Design has an interface that's easy to use and nice to look it. This design pattern has become the norm for mobile applications, however, mobile websites that are translated down to mobile screen sizes still haven't fully adopted this approach. by Theresa Neil. The screen can be unlocked in a few seconds, and a free trial is available. Mobile application design has exploded with new design patterns and their implementations . Allow people to easily enter data in your app - Compelling Design Patterns for Mobile Forms. Gradually a set of patterns, at a higher level than OS specific design guidelines, emerged. Pitchfork's desktop and mobile web designs featuring a bottom navigation bar in the mobile design. When to use. Mobile OSes have become increasingly different, driving their own design conventions and patterns, and many designers have embraced mobile . The idea was introduced by the. There are a few mobile UI pattern sites on the web; pttrns and Mary Sheibley's Mobile-Patterns are the most comprehensive. 8, no. O'Reilly members get unlimited access to live online training experiences, plus books, videos, and digital content from O'Reilly and nearly . Clear CTA tips. Any lock screen scenario is supported by the tool. Team 195 22.4k Riotters Team 289 The design presents a . My Pattern Designer can be used to design clothes for men, women, and children. Both sites provide examples of common design idioms. onboarding. Pattern Tap is closing on 10,000 User Generated Sets of patterns and that makes it an awe inspiring resource for UI designers. splash screens walkthroughs sign up flows coach marks. Halo Lab Team. Functionality and user experience are not everything. Save hours of UI & UX research with our library of 100,000+ fully searchable mobile app screenshots. The adapter design pattern's purpose is to lay down criteria that make classes work together that could not otherwise because of incompatible interfaces. iOS Design Patterns . Table of Contents Benefits of JavaScript Design Patterns JavaScript Design Pattern Categories with Examples 1. 1,234,000+ Vectors, Stock Photos & PSD files. You'll learn core principles for designing effective user interfaces, along with a set of common patterns for interaction design on all types of mobile devices. Seamless Seamless at any resolution Endless opportunities of using Free Samples Formats Vector (svg,eps,pdf) One can choose a base style and customize it with filters, colors, and transforms. The " Priority+ " mobile navigation design pattern was coined by Michael Scharnagl to describe navigation that works well for responsive design. Get inspired by these patterns made of all kinds of elements. User experience professional Theresa Neil (Designing When you're under pressure to produce a well designed, easy-to-navigate mobile app, there . camera controller stats empty data sets timelines. This UX design pattern library is a valuable source to make research for your future mobile application. Thousands of new images every day Completely Free to Use High-quality videos and images from Pexels This is generally used as app. Create iOS and Android Icons. Designers can add favorites to their own library. Essentially, the higher on the screen an element is on the screen, the harder it is to reach with one's thumb. #freepik To do this, we will discuss three of the main approaches when using repeated design elements: repetition; pattern and rhythm. Rather than guiding the design of a specific feature, this mobile web design pattern applies to mobile website layouts in general. I talk about this at greater length in Mobile Design UI Patterns but want to touch on it briefly because of it's significance. WELIE Interaction Design Patterns. The program comes with a set of patterns for easy design. Pattern Design is a stock platform for buying and selling high-quality seamless vector patterns. We have discussed the essential types of design patterns in this blog. It offers a free pattern generator tool that helps a user create unique, seamless, and royalty-free patterns. The . Example. State pattern is used to provide a systematic and lose-coupled . It helps in reducing total cost of ownership (TCO) of the software product. The obvious setback for this is that it will not have updated content since these are just remnants of a website. Using design patterns promotes reusability that leads to more robust and highly maintainable code. As we. This concise book provides a handy reference to 70 mobile app design patterns, illustrated by more than 400 screenshots from current iOS, Android, BlackBerry, WebOS, Windows Mobile, and Symbian apps. Whenever you download one of our free and premium images for your projects, you know you'll come back to download more! If you just expose everything right from the start, your users will get scrolling vertigo and risk feeling overwhelmed. Courses. State design pattern is used when an Object changes its behavior based on its internal state. Leverages the Observer pattern to update with Model and display the updated model when necessary. The adapter is also known as wrapper. Find & Download Free Graphic Resources for Pattern Design. 1. You can also buy additional designs from the developer. 6 Basic Design Patterns for Mobile Forms. the application of design patterns to develop games for mobile devices using java 2 micro edition 154 journal of object technology vol. Mobile Design Pattern Gallery. Not only do we have to effectively convey the interaction exists in the first place, the object needs to physically move, the live feedback second to second matters, and there are lots of decisions to make throughout to make it 'feel' the right way. Used daily by individuals, teams, and companies of all sizes What you get UX and UI Patterns Mobile OSes have become increasingly different, driving their own design conventions and patterns, and many designers have embraced mobile . 1. iphone. As design patterns are often traditionally used by software developers, we can be certain that they work, have been revised multiple times and probably optimised during implementations. Afterglow Team 633 115k CASE STUDY Bruno. 1,758 inspirational designs, illustrations, and graphic elements from the world's best designers. Each design has to go through a refined curating process to make sure each new repeat pattern meets our high standards. It allows you to remove the four major screen lock types, including pattern, PIN, password, and fingerprints. The idea is to speed up the development process by providing well-tested, proven development/design paradigms. Facebook uses a hamburger menu, a top navigation bar as well as a bottom navigation bar. Design patterns are one of most controversial topics in software development. The push design pattern can be illustrated though a simple example scenario that, if extended to its logical conclusion, could make the Check Balance button in a mobile banking app a thing of the . Geometric shapes and patterns make for fantastic UX-UI design, and are super popular in app design at the moment. These 70 patterns, illustrated with hundreds of examples from iOS, BlackBerry, Android, Symbian, Windows and webOS applications, will be released this month from O'Reilly Media as the "Mobile Design Pattern Gallery". It got nicknamed as Gangs of Four design patterns because of four authors. Publisher (s): O'Reilly Media, Inc. ISBN: 9781449314323. Start 3-day free trial! It exposes what's deemed to be the most important navigation elements and hides away less important items behind a "more" button. The program comes with both detailed sewing instructions for every pattern of the product . It is a description or template for how to solve a problem that can be . This article explains the top five JavaScript design patterns, most of which naturally fit into one of three categories: Design themes, Structural engineering patterns, and Behavioural design patterns. Released March 2012. Interaction Design Pattern - "Pull down to refresh" for Content Updates & New Feeds in Social Networking Apps. For its mobile header design, they went with the same methodology as any other content sharing platform, and that is to share the trending content upfront. It leads to faster development and new members of team understand it easily. Design patterns represent the best practices used by experienced object-oriented software developers. Browse our search results . Notifications Permissions cool feedbacks emotional design. The intent is to convert the interface of one class into another interface so that it becomes compatible with what the client expects. RRP $11.95 Get the book free! Much has changed since this book's first edition. UI Parade